HSE 'really struggling' amid latest Covid-19 surge
The Department of Health has been notified of 8,910 PCR-confirmed cases of Covid-19, as well as 14,215 positive antigen tests logged through the HSE portal. As of 8am, there were 1,425 Covid patients in hospital, up 30 on the same time yesterday morning. Of them, 53 patients were being treated in ICU, a decrease of 2 from Wednesday. Meanwhile, Taoiseach Micheál Martin said people should continue to be cautious and to wear masks in crowded situations, but that the current Covid wave was less 'impactful' and virulent than earlier variants, so no new economic restrictions were warranted.
